VAL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review
306 of the 6,964 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Valaris (VAL)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$3.8B — down 28% from $5.3B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 61 funds opened new VAL positions and 45 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 126 added to existing stakes and 82 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Condire Management, adding an estimated $34.3M. The largest seller was Marshall Wace, cutting an estimated $79.9M.
